网站设计能出来什么,wordpress 商城 插件,海外社交媒体平台,微信公众号的小程序怎么开发一、数据设计规范 1、表的前缀 1、表名称不应该取得太长#xff08;一般不超过三个英文单词。不推荐使用中文拼音#xff0c;总的长度不要超过30个字符#xff09; 格式:Tbl_Wms_log 表示 表_Wms系统_log 好处:执行查询方式辨别SQL类别(T_表-Table、V_视图-View、S_存储过…一、数据设计规范 1、表的前缀 1、表名称不应该取得太长一般不超过三个英文单词。不推荐使用中文拼音总的长度不要超过30个字符 格式:Tbl_Wms_log 表示 表_Wms系统_log 好处:执行查询方式辨别SQL类别(T_表-Table、V_视图-View、S_存储过程)比如我想知道所有关于user的表直接show tables like %user%就可以了用mysql命令行的就知道。 从使用角度思考-(因为联表查询的时候我们考虑使用表还是视图就输入 Tbl 提示下拉的然后我们在考虑 什么系统 Wms下log)。 2、表名字命名 (一般就两种 全写和缩写以及多个字母加_分割, 考虑TB_还是_Tbl 还是t_ 当表多 我觉得还是Tbl _比较恰当t_表开头小写看不惯TB_ 就一个单词两个都小写也不喜欢Tb 一个首字母大写2个字母小写如何一个字母大写 一个小写 没有必要不合适尽量保持 两个小写的字母标准可以的 Tbl) 直白说四个单词就全写和其他单词缩写首字母单词缩写两个字母小写 至于 取两个小写字母按照以下规则 我自己的规范 1、result -res取前三个单词 2、loan四个单词的 3、 取中间三个单词 4、一个单词的时候 不长 就可以写全的 Content Result 也行 res 也行 缩写:五笔拆字法取字母一个单词取前四个字母 要是我自己就是 首字母大写单词数小于等于三个 全写大于就是 单词的缩写或者去首个单或者中间加尾部 例如Table Tbe Tbl ,Result Res 取三个吧根据单词而定 Data 这种 就全部取四个四个单词特殊四个单词就全写五个单词以上就是取三个二个单词取每个单词的前两个字母 LoanLog 字母数不多 全写Data Assessment DataAst 单词短就全写后面就是首中尾取单词-这种不符合见名知意一般单词字母都是连续才有含义的 尽量取连续几个字母比如第一个前四个方便模糊匹配三个单词取前两个单词的首字母和第三个单词的前两个字母。 也可以第一个单词 全写第二个全首字母前两个第三个单子 单词随意 情况而定 也就前四个把四或四个以上取前三个单词的首字母和最后一个单词的首字母。 一般没有 3、表的字段名命名规范表如果是一个单词就可以表示 就加Info 两个单词好看比如LoanInfo 字段就是LI 一般表与表的联查都是 一个系统的里面的 所以不需要Wms 系统名字的缩写 直接写表的逻辑单词名字前缀即可。 1、但是还是容易表的单词 容易重复-待解决 表的缩写不可以重复(同一个系统模块内) 2、住外建 也很好区分 3、表的备注格式(缩写)说明 字段就是缩写_字段的名字 解决方案 常见的几个表详细说明操作日志表Sys_OperateLog、登录日志表Sys_LoginLog、 系统字典表Sys_Dictionary、系统字典表类型Sys_DicType 注意都是表 详细表名几个单词就几个单词的首字母即可 二、数据设计三大范式 设计什么样我们获取的数据就是怎么样。 设计考虑实体与实体间的关系方便查询数据联查的时候一对多 还是多对多 查询数据 从使用角度思考查询会考虑表与表对应所以定义结构应该定义好。转载于:https://www.cnblogs.com/fger/p/11144919.html